Objection to detention filed: New development regarding Kerimcan Durmaz
The request for an 'objection to detention' filed by the lawyer of social media influencer Kerimcan Durmaz, who was arrested on allegations of encouraging people by advertising illegal betting, has been rejected.
The Istanbul Chief Public Prosecutor's Office had launched an investigation into social media influencer Kerimcan Durmaz on the grounds that he carried out activities encouraging illegal betting and shared advertising content in an irregular manner.
In this context, Durmaz was taken into custody on January 7 and was referred to the courthouse the following day, where he was arrested by the Istanbul Criminal Court of Peace.
The petition submitted by his lawyer, Müge Doğan, to the Istanbul 10th Criminal Court of Peace to object to her client's detention was rejected by the duty court. The court ruled for the continuation of Durmaz's detention.
